Still dark and
gloomy with a drissling rain. Our Regt.
returned about 8½ O'clock had no brush with the Enemy took 600 or 700 bushels
wheat & 4 secesh prisoners. Battalion Drill this afternoon
Camp McClernand Cairo Ills.
Nothing of an
exciting character has transpired to day O & Co. of Light Artillery left
camp cairo this afternoon where bound tis not known with us. Hickman &
Brown were with the Regt. found Wm Sullivan today.
SOURCE: Transactions
of the Illinois State Historical Society for the Year 1909, p. 229
